The interior problems that don't announce themselves
A burst laundry hose, a clogged dryer vent, a spreading ceiling stain โ none of these make noise or trigger an alarm. In an occupied home, someone notices within a day or two. In a Babcock Ranch home that sits closed up between an owner's visits, these are exactly the kind of quiet, interior problems that can run unchecked for weeks. What appliances get checked?
A visual check of major appliances during the walkthrough โ confirming they're not showing signs of malfunction, leaking, or damage. It's a visual check, not a technical diagnostic of each appliance's internal components.
Why check the ceiling specifically?
Ceiling stains or discoloration are often the first visible sign of a roof leak or an AC condensate problem happening above โ catching a stain early, while it's still small, is a lot cheaper than finding it after it's spread.
What's a laundry connection check?
A look at the washing machine's water supply hoses and connections. These are a common source of major water damage โ a burst supply hose can release a large volume of water fast, and in an empty house nobody's there to shut off the water.
Why does dryer vent inspection matter?
A lint-clogged dryer vent is a genuine fire risk, and it's one of those things nobody thinks about until it's a problem. It's a quick visual check as part of the regular visit.
